How they compare

Chad currently reports 4,127 1000 ha against 4,102 1000 ha in Cambodia, a difference of 25 1000 ha.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 24 shared years of data; in 2001 it was Cambodia ahead.

Cambodia ranks 48th and Chad ranks 47th of 225 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Cambodia averaged higher in 2 and Chad in 1.

The FAOSTAT Land Use domain contains data on twenty-one land use categories and twenty-three categories of irrigation and agricultural practices. Data are available yearly and by country, regional and global levels. The domain includes Land Use Indicators providing information on the percentage share of agricultural and forest land, and their sub-components, including irrigated areas and areas under organic agriculture, within a country land use matrix. Data are available at country, regional and global level, for the following elements: (in percentage) i) Share in Land area; ii) Share in Agricultural land, iii) Share in Cropland; and iv) Share in Forest land; (in ha/pc) v) Area per capita.
